Kid Howard

Howard began on drums at about age fourteen, but switched to cornet and then trumpet after playing with Chris Kelly.

[3] In 1946, he led the Original Zenith Brass Band, but played only locally for the next few years.

His later recordings with Lewis are uneven because he was battling with alcoholism, which interfered with his abilities as a soloist.

[3] He fell ill in 1961 and left Lewis's band, and upon his recovery he led his own band from 1961 to 1965 and recorded several times; these recordings were also highly praised.

[4] He continued to play in New Orleans at Preservation Hall and other venues up until his death of a brain hemorrhage in 1966.
